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to employees, visitors, and/or vendors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ities at a financial services location.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and/or crit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, and communicate relevant details to site contacts and Allied Universal management.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the lobby, common areas, offices, exterior grounds, and/or per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ify unusual conditions.
  • Monitor access points and assist with visitor, employee, and/or contractor entry procedures in accordance with site protocols for a professional financial institution environment.
  • Prepare clear, timely reports of incidents, observations, and/or daily activities, and report maintenance concerns, suspicious behavior, or policy violations to appropriate personnel.
